Altice Europe to buy telecoms fibre company Covage for $1.1 billion
Share:
PARIS (Reuters) - Debt-ridden telecoms and cable company Altice Europe said it would acquire French fibre wholesale operator Covage for about 1 billion euros ($1.1 billion), expanding the range of its fibre network business.Telecoms infrastructure has been a focus for takeover activity this year as countries invest in new networks.
